2009-04-01 |
Chris Lattner | silence warning in release-asserts build. |
tree | commitdiff |
2009-04-01 |
Dan Gohman | Use CHAR_BIT instead of hard-coding 8 in several places... |
tree | commitdiff |
2009-04-01 |
Dan Gohman | Use LLVM type names instead of C type names in comments... |
tree | commitdiff |
2009-04-01 |
Bob Wilson | Fix PR3862: Recognize some ARM-specific constraints... |
tree | commitdiff |
2009-03-31 |
Evan Cheng | i128 shift libcalls are not available on x86. |
tree | commitdiff |
2009-03-31 |
Dan Gohman | Reapply 68073, with fixes. EH Landing-pad basic blocks... |
tree | commitdiff |
2009-03-31 |
Rafael Espindola | remove unused arguments. |
tree | commitdiff |
2009-03-31 |
Bill Wendling | Really temporarily revert r68073. |
tree | commitdiff |
2009-03-31 |
Bill Wendling | Oy! When reverting r68073, I added in experimental... |
tree | commitdiff |
2009-03-31 |
Bill Wendling | Revert r68073. It's causing a failure in the Apple... |
tree | commitdiff |
2009-03-31 |
Evan Cheng | X86 address mode isel tweak. If the base of the address... |
tree | commitdiff |
2009-03-30 |
Dan Gohman | Except in asm-verbose mode, avoid printing labels for... |
tree | commitdiff |
2009-03-30 |
Evan Cheng | When optimzing a mul by immediate into two, the resulti... |
tree | commitdiff |
2009-03-30 |
Bob Wilson | Fix comment to match function name. |
tree | commitdiff |
2009-03-30 |
Anton Korobeynikov | Fix thinko: put stuff with both global and local reloca... |
tree | commitdiff |
2009-03-30 |
Anton Korobeynikov | Do not propagate ELF-specific stuff (data.rel) into... |
tree | commitdiff |
2009-03-30 |
Anton Korobeynikov | Add data.rel stuff |
tree | commitdiff |
2009-03-29 |
Anton Korobeynikov | IA64 is as weird as Alpha wrt r/o relocs :) |
tree | commitdiff |
2009-03-29 |
Anton Korobeynikov | Alpha always requires global relocations to be r/w... |
tree | commitdiff |
2009-03-29 |
Anton Korobeynikov | Honour relocation behaviour stuff for ro objects |
tree | commitdiff |
2009-03-28 |
Chris Lattner | add a note |
tree | commitdiff |
2009-03-28 |
Rafael Espindola | Use array_lengthof |
tree | commitdiff |
2009-03-28 |
Rafael Espindola | Have only one definition of X86AddrNumOperands. |
tree | commitdiff |
2009-03-28 |
Rafael Espindola | Make code a bit less brittle by no hardcoding the number |
tree | commitdiff |
2009-03-28 |
Evan Cheng | Optimize some 64-bit multiplication by constants into... |
tree | commitdiff |
2009-03-27 |
Jim Grosbach | remove trailing whitespace |
tree | commitdiff |
2009-03-27 |
Rafael Espindola | Avoid hardcoding that X86 addresses have 4 operands. |
tree | commitdiff |
2009-03-27 |
Rafael Espindola | Use less hard coded constants to make the code less... |
tree | commitdiff |
2009-03-27 |
Rafael Espindola | I am trying to add a segment to the X86 addresses match... |
tree | commitdiff |
2009-03-26 |
Evan Cheng | -no-implicit-float means explicit fp operations are... |
tree | commitdiff |
2009-03-26 |
Evan Cheng | tADDhirr is a thumb instruction. Do not allow this... |
tree | commitdiff |
2009-03-26 |
Bill Wendling | Pull transform from target-dependent code into target... |
tree | commitdiff |
2009-03-26 |
Chris Lattner | fix warning in -asserts mode. |
tree | commitdiff |
2009-03-26 |
Chris Lattner | fix some warnings in release-asserts mode. |
tree | commitdiff |
2009-03-26 |
Chris Lattner | fix an apparently real bug exposed by a warning in... |
tree | commitdiff |
2009-03-26 |
Chris Lattner | fix warning in -asserts build. |
tree | commitdiff |
2009-03-26 |
Bill Wendling | Match this pattern so that we can generate simpler... |
tree | commitdiff |
2009-03-26 |
Bill Wendling | Doxygen-ify comments. |
tree | commitdiff |
2009-03-25 |
Gabor Greif | do not rely on callee being operand 0 |
tree | commitdiff |
2009-03-25 |
Evan Cheng | CodeGen still defaults to non-verbose asm, but llc... |
tree | commitdiff |
2009-03-25 |
Evan Cheng | Don't print global names twice with -asm-verbose. |
tree | commitdiff |
2009-03-24 |
Dan Gohman | I was convinced that it's ok to allow a second i8 retur... |
tree | commitdiff |
2009-03-24 |
Evan Cheng | Do not emit comments unless -asm-verbose. |
tree | commitdiff |
2009-03-23 |
Dale Johannesen | Fix internal representation of fp80 to be the |
tree | commitdiff |
2009-03-23 |
Dan Gohman | Now that errs() is properly non-buffered, there's no... |
tree | commitdiff |
2009-03-23 |
Dan Gohman | Correct some comments. Operand numbers start at 0. |
tree | commitdiff |
2009-03-23 |
Evan Cheng | Model inline asm constraint which ties an input to... |
tree | commitdiff |
2009-03-23 |
Dan Gohman | Fix a grammaro in a comment that Bill noticed. |
tree | commitdiff |
2009-03-23 |
Dan Gohman | Add comments explaining why there's only one register for |
tree | commitdiff |
2009-03-21 |
Bruno Cardoso Lopes | Removed AFGR32 register class |
tree | commitdiff |
2009-03-20 |
Bob Wilson | Fix a few more indentation problems and an 80-column... |
tree | commitdiff |
2009-03-20 |
Bob Wilson | No functional changes. Fix indentation and whitespace... |
tree | commitdiff |
2009-03-20 |
Sanjiv Gupta | Fixed comment for libcalls. |
tree | commitdiff |
2009-03-20 |
Sanjiv Gupta | Reformatting. Inserted code comments. Cleaned interfaces. |
tree | commitdiff |
2009-03-20 |
Mon P Wang | Added option to enable generating less precise mad... |
tree | commitdiff |
2009-03-19 |
Nick Lewycky | Remove strange extra semicolons. |
tree | commitdiff |
2009-03-19 |
Nate Begeman | Add support to tablegen for naming the nodes themselves... |
tree | commitdiff |
2009-03-19 |
Bruno Cardoso Lopes | Added support for Mips O32 Calling Convention |
tree | commitdiff |
2009-03-18 |
Chris Lattner | Disable the "call to immediate" optimization on x86... |
tree | commitdiff |
2009-03-17 |
Scott Michel | CellSPU: |
tree | commitdiff |
2009-03-17 |
Dan Gohman | Recognize bswapl as bswap too. |
tree | commitdiff |
2009-03-17 |
Dan Gohman | Recognize "bswapq" as an alternate spelling for the... |
tree | commitdiff |
2009-03-17 |
Scott Michel | CellSPU: |
tree | commitdiff |
2009-03-16 |
Scott Michel | CellSPU: |
tree | commitdiff |
2009-03-15 |
Bruno Cardoso Lopes | This causes incorrect stack frame allocation when the... |
tree | commitdiff |
2009-03-14 |
Dan Gohman | Use %rip-relative addressing on x86-64 whenever practic... |
tree | commitdiff |
2009-03-14 |
Dan Gohman | Don't forego folding of loads into 64-bit adds when... |
tree | commitdiff |
2009-03-13 |
Dan Gohman | Improve FastISel's handling of truncates to i1, and... |
tree | commitdiff |
2009-03-13 |
Dan Gohman | Fix FastISel's assumption that i1 values are always... |
tree | commitdiff |
2009-03-13 |
Rafael Espindola | add 8 and 16 bit TLS moves. |
tree | commitdiff |
2009-03-13 |
Rafael Espindola | Improve sext and zext of TLS variables. |
tree | commitdiff |
2009-03-13 |
Chris Lattner | generalize this code so that fast isel handles integer... |
tree | commitdiff |
2009-03-13 |
Bill Wendling | These instructions have special lowering that may lower... |
tree | commitdiff |
2009-03-13 |
Evan Cheng | Fix some significant problems with constant pools that... |
tree | commitdiff |
2009-03-13 |
Chris Lattner | generalize the previous code to use the full generality... |
tree | commitdiff |
2009-03-13 |
Chris Lattner | optimize the case of cond ? 42 : 41 and friends. This... |
tree | commitdiff |
2009-03-13 |
Dan Gohman | Enhance address-mode folding of ISD::ADD to handle... |
tree | commitdiff |
2009-03-12 |
Evan Cheng | Re-apply 66024 with fixes: 1. Fixed indirect call to... |
tree | commitdiff |
2009-03-12 |
Chris Lattner | Move 3 "(add (select cc, 0, c), x) -> (select cc, x... |
tree | commitdiff |
2009-03-12 |
Chris Lattner | improve comment. |
tree | commitdiff |
2009-03-12 |
Evan Cheng | On x86, if the only use of a i64 load is a i64 store... |
tree | commitdiff |
2009-03-12 |
Sanjiv Gupta | Forgot to check-in this as part of 7761. |
tree | commitdiff |
2009-03-12 |
Sanjiv Gupta | Banksel optimization is now based on the section names... |
tree | commitdiff |
2009-03-11 |
Dan Gohman | Revert r66024. The JIT encoding for CALLpcrel32 is... |
tree | commitdiff |
2009-03-11 |
Rafael Espindola | optimize i8 and i16 tls values. |
tree | commitdiff |
2009-03-11 |
Bill Wendling | Add a -no-implicit-float flag. This acts like -soft... |
tree | commitdiff |
2009-03-11 |
Duncan Sands | It makes no sense to have a ODR version of common |
tree | commitdiff |
2009-03-11 |
Mon P Wang | For yonah, fix a vector shuffle case for v16i8 where... |
tree | commitdiff |
2009-03-11 |
Chris Lattner | fix PR3785, a valgrind error on test/CodeGen/ARM/pr3502.ll |
tree | commitdiff |
2009-03-11 |
Duncan Sands | Remove the one-definition-rule version of extern_weak |
tree | commitdiff |
2009-03-11 |
Mon P Wang | Fixed a v8i16 shuffle case that should generate a pshuf... |
tree | commitdiff |
2009-03-11 |
Chris Lattner | formatting change, reduce indentation. No functionalit... |
tree | commitdiff |
2009-03-10 |
Sanjiv Gupta | Mark the Defs and Uses of STATUS register correctly... |
tree | commitdiff |
2009-03-10 |
Dan Gohman | Add more information to the EFLAGS note. |
tree | commitdiff |
2009-03-09 |
Dan Gohman | Add a note about EFLAGS optimization. |
tree | commitdiff |
2009-03-09 |
Evan Cheng | ARM target now also recognize triplets like thumbv6... |
tree | commitdiff |
2009-03-09 |
Evan Cheng | ARM isLegalAddressImmediate should check if type is... |
tree | commitdiff |
2009-03-08 |
Chris Lattner | do not export all the X86FastISel symbols, ever. |
tree | commitdiff |
2009-03-08 |
Evan Cheng | Recognize triplets starting with armv5-, armv6- etc... |
tree | commitdiff |
2009-03-08 |
Chris Lattner | add a note. |
tree | commitdiff |
next |